Florida rules that matter while you rent

Advance Notice for Entry

We give at least 24 hours’ notice for repairs and enter only between 7:30 a.m.–8:00 p.m. except emergencies. Details are also available on our General Information page.

If Rent Isn’t Paid

Florida allows a 3-day notice (excluding weekends and holidays) after rent is due. For more rent-related details, visit our Information page.

Security Deposit Timeline

If no claim is made, deposits are returned within 15 days. If a claim is made, notice is mailed within 30 days. Curious how deposits affect your final move-out? See our General Information.

Extermination & Temporary Vacate

In multi-family buildings we arrange regular extermination. If treatment requires you to vacate, we give 7 days’ notice. Rent is abated up to 4 days. See more building policies on our Information page.

No Lockouts or Utility Shutoffs

Florida law prohibits lockouts, removing doors/windows, or shutting off utilities to force a move-out. We never use those tactics and work with every resident. For your rights, check our Information page.

Assistance Animals

Assistance animals are not pets. We review reasonable-accommodation requests per HUD guidance. For more lease-specific rules, see General Information.

Move-Out Prep & Deposit Return

  • Review your lease for the minimum notice needed.
  • Inside AppFolio, go to “Contact Us” → “Request Notice To Vacate.”
  • Provide your forwarding address in writing.
  • Leave the home clean and return all keys/fobs/decals.
  • Refund within 15 days if no claim; claim notice mailed within 30 days. For more details, visit General Information.

Hurricane Season Readiness

  • Secure outdoor items and follow building rules for shutters.
  • Do not place storm debris curbside after watches/warnings begin.
  • Sign up for AlertPBC for county alerts.
